Next week the UK budget will be handed down.
The government has already said they’ve run out of money and need to find some more. But they have limited options.
All eyes are on the way they tax entrepreneurs and businesses. Arguably the engine of growth in the UK.
Already 1% of people pay 29% of income tax - And 10% pay 60%!
Already the Government spending is 45% of the economy (🤮 🤦♂️). Already the UK has 500,000 civil servants! Already 10,000 millionaires have exited the UK. It could be a total disaster to take this insanity further.
I believe, based on evidence and sound theory, that there comes a point where higher tax rates collects LESS in tax revenue. The higher rates reduce ambition or makes people leave. Every business owner knows that putting prices up too high without offering great value will decimate revenues.
